support a cause that matters to you. About you: We are seeking a highly organized and dynamic individual to join our team as an Executive Assistant and Internal Communications Lead. This dual role requires a proactive, detail-oriented professional who can provide executive-level support to the SVP of Sales while also leading and managing internal communications strategies to the global Sales teams. You will possess excellent organisational, communication, and interpersonal skills, with the ability to handle sensitive information with discretion. Day-to-day, you will:

  • Provide high-level administrative support to the executive team, including calendar management, travel arrangements, meeting coordination, and expense reporting. Handle incoming calls, emails, and other communications, directing inquiries to the appropriate parties and managing responses. Prepare and edit correspondence, communications, presentations, and other documents. Create and distribute

  • internal communications, such as newsletters, announcements, and updates, ensuring clarity, consistency, and engagement.
  • Collaborate with Employee Success, Sales Enablement, Sales Incentives and other departments to support employee engagement initiatives and enhance company culture. Coordinate and support company events, town halls, and other internal functions. Assist with special projects and other duties as assigned by the executive team. Your skills and experiences might also include: Direct experience supporting a board-level leader within a global organisation within an EA capacity. Previous experience creating internal communication initiatives, ideally within a Sales organisation. Exceptional organisational and time management skills, with the ability to multitask and prioritize effectively. Excellent written and verbal communication skills, with a keen eye for detail. The Access Group is one of the largest UK-headquartered providers of business management software to small and mid-sized organisations in the UK, Ireland, USA and Asia Pacific. It helps more than 100,000 customers across commercial and non-profit sectors become more productive and efficient.
